The contract focuses on developing full-time equivalent (FTE) staffing models and audit planning frameworks specifically tailored for the Department of Veterans Affairs' enterprise cybersecurity audits. This includes responsibilities such as forecasting resource needs and distributing workloads effectively to ensure comprehensive and efficient audit processes. The effort aims to enhance the strategic allocation of cybersecurity audit personnel and streamline audit planning. Issued as a subcontract under the NAICS code 541611, the contract is managed through the Technology Acquisition Center Nj within the Department of Veterans Affairs. Although specific location details and points of contact are not provided, the scope clearly centers on improving enterprise-wide cybersecurity audit capabilities through detailed staffing analytics and structured planning methodologies. The contract was posted in early May 2026 and supports the VA’s mission to safeguard its information systems by establishing solid operational foundations for audit readiness.
